Surfer attacked by unknown species of shark near Leeman, in WA’s Mid West

A surfer has been bitten by a shark at Gum Tree Bay, near Leeman, about 300 kilometres north of Perth.
Emergency services received a call about 2:00pm from a member of the public saying there had been a shark attack.
